Support Our Community by Taking Action this September

Hunger Action Month is a nationwide initiative to raise awareness of hunger and encourage people to take action towards supporting those facing hunger and address the systemic inequities that can lead to someone being food insecure. 

There are a variety of ways people can take action to support those facing hunger. Financial gifts, gifts of time volunteering and sharing information about hunger, its causes, and the ways to address it in person or via social media are just a few of the ways people can take action.  

Everyone deserves to have access to enough nutritious food to thrive. This September, let’s all take action towards making that vision a reality.
